Starting forth by leo brodie pdf

Forth a very special high level computer language or as somebody called it recently. Introduction to the forth language and operating system for beginners and professionals leo brodie for beginners and professionals, this popular and complete introduction to forth syntax has been expanded to include the new forth83 standard. A good book now available is starting forth, by leo brodie. This primer was written in the hope that it will be useful and that starting forthers arent put off by the high price of forth textbooks. Theres a great introductory book for forth, starting forth by leo brodie. It was first published way back in 1981, so there are differences between the forths covered in this book and flashforth. A pdf of this wonderful book is available for download. Forth is an imperative stackbased computer programming language and environment originally designed by charles chuck moore. In 1994 the ans forth standard was released and unleashed a wave. Java language reference mark grand oreilly, published in 1997, 492 pages.

Starting forth string computer science assembly language. Leo brodie is the author of starting forth and thinking forth. Im trying to learning forth directly in an embedded system and using starting forth by leo brodie as a text. A small supply of about 500 books was all that was left when you can get hold of the original, do so. It brings back some memories i have a couple of tubes of the rtx2000 forth engine chips left over from a real time. Leo brodie books list of books by author leo brodie. Even better, it is legally available online for free from two sources. These web pages were designed in 2003, when it became apparent that sf would never be reissued by the holder. A web version by marcel hendrix is described as a tribute to this great book and is available for reading. It deftly guides the novice over the thresholds of understanding that all forth programmers must cross. With a good book and a good forth computer, i think all we common people, or idiots, should be able to learn forth and use it to enjoy the company of a computer without much help from high priests of the forth religion. This book is an original and detailed prescription for learning. Leo brodie starting forth introduction to the forth language and operating system for beginners and professionals. In this chapter well acquaint you with some of the unique properties of the forth language.

Another window is provided by jfars invaluable subject and author index martin 1987. Language features include structured programming, reflection the ability to examine and modify program structure during execution, concatenative programming functions are composed with juxtaposition and extensibility the programmer can create new commands. Check out leo brodies book starting forth, cited below. Leo brodie is the master of suspense and irony as he rolls through what might otherwise be a geeky subject. This free book is a userfriendly beginners tutorial on the forth programing language. Published first in 1984, it could be among the timeless classics of computer books, such as fred brooks the mythical manmonth and donald knuths the art. Forth is more fun to write programs with than any language that i know of. If you want to learn more about forth, another book of mine, starting. None of the books about forth quite capture its flavor. Forth systemonchip takes us back to the 80s hackaday. Programming forth by stephen pelc of mpe pdf site1 site2. Thinking forth applies a philosophy of problem solving and programming style to the unique programming language forth.

Everyone seems to agree that 1 forth is a great language, 2 starting forth is a great book, and 3 leo brodie is a great writer. A greater effort, talent, and commitment have gone into this book than into any previous introductory manual. For several years i used the language to teach fundamentals of programming, using this book as a reference. Starting forth by leo brodie starting forth, the classic forth language tutorial, is available here in its official online edition. Sadly out of print, but if you find a copy, especially of the second edition, buy it.

I contacted leo brodie to discuss the conditions under which he would be willing to allow republishing thinking forth, in electronic format under an open content license. I think the best is still the first, starting forth by leo brodie brodie 1981. It is our pleasure to now present both a downloadable pdf of starting forth first edition as will as an updated online edition, with great. Leo brodie thinking forth a language and philosophy for solving problems includes interviews with forths inventor, c h. Starting forth prenticehall software series by leo brodie english jan. Starting forth was written and illustrated by leo brodie, a remarkably capable person whose insight and imagination will become apparent. The same was true of the forth programming language, so the whimsical cartoons and illustrations leo brodie brought to his book caused concern in some quarters. Starting forth pdf by leo brodie is an excellent introduction to forth and how it works. If you want to learn more about forth, another book of mine, start. Leo brodie thinking forth a language and philosophy for solving problems. Leos style of writing keeps the reader amused while educating on the benefits of this stack oriented language. Many software engineering principles discussed here have been. See all books authored by leo brodie, including starting forth, and thinking forth, and more on thriftbooks.

Thinking forth is a book about the philosophy of problem solving and programming style, applied to the unique programming language forth. Some free forths do odd things with their command lines and such i use brodies starting forth as the model of how a forth interpreter should behave. I have therefore added substitute graphic elements, roughly at the same spot where they are in the original. A good startingpoint for thinking forth would be leos other book starting forth. Another selling point of thinking forth is its claimed pioneering of practices later rediscovered in extreme programming xp. Crooked thief pintaske owns forth and threatens all the forth community showing 186 of 86 messages. It is dedicated to leo brodie, who taught me much more than just forth. Forthforthe omplete idiot forth interest group home page. Published first in 1984, it could be among the timeless classics of computer books, such as fred brooks the mythical manmonth and donald knuths the art of computer programming. The vlist command will print a short summary of known words. The classic forth we are discussing provides the minimum support a programmer needs to develop a language optimized for. Imho, it is a topoftheline introductory programming book by any standard. Introduction 1 introduction about this book programming forth introduces you to modern forth systems. Starting forth is full of very difficult to reproduce graphics.

The book thinking forth is a book about the philosophy of problem solving and programming style, applied to the unique programming language forth. The book arrived at a time when personal computers still were striving to be taken seriously. Updates to the original starting forth text include code examples that run on iforth and swiftforth systems. Most people who subscribe to this channel did so for my gardening permaculture transition towns videos. Starting forth by leo brodie forth inc on line version also see starting forth 2nd edition by leo brodie forth inc on line version thinking forth leo brodie. Leo brodies starting forth intro foreword the forth community can celebrate a significant event with the publication of starting forth. Read it online and read about forth itself here and here beware that the forth dialect in the book starting forth is a bit outdated compared to atlast forth.

It is our pleasure to now present both a downloadable pdf of starting forth. Review the glossary to see the words in this version. I looked at swiftforth, which is a very nice high tech forth system that goes well beyond what the classic forths offer in terms of language features and really brings forth into the. He is also the author of starting forth prenticehall, 1982. I, particularly, am pleased at this evidence of the growing popularity of forth, the language. Language and operating system for beginners and professionals.

These enormously enhance the texts mnemonic value, and are invaluable for a firsttime forth user. Developing modern mobile web apps microsoft corporation, published in 2012, 112 pages. Starting forth was written and illustrated by leo brodie, a remarkably. Since the book went out of print now the second time due to fig folding up fig did the reprint, he allowed to publish thinking forth as electronic book under a creative commons license attribute, noncommercial, sharealike. After a few introductory pages well have you sitting at a forth terminal. Well worth a play with if you have not tried it yet.

Leo brodie s starting forth intro about this book welcome to starting forth, your introduction to an exciting and powerful computer language called forth. He steeled all public domain documents of forth, inclusive starting forth of leo brodie, as you see i can not exchange to a friend anymore on my site it seems all belongs to him. Leo brodie wrote another book, thinking forth, read it here and here. Fig hold a of books, some of which may be purchased in this country through bookshops, and they should be happy to send you a membership formpublications list. Leo brodie starting forth introduction to the forth language.

1032 998 1137 1404 269 1185 1137 151 931 825 328 1368 1252 1244 312 1368 450 28 1235 237 311 1387 1331 1068 44 836 698 985 897 234 405 978 625 340 1101 610 1369 364 167 1398 1260 348 606 822 871